Alaska is a vast and photo rich destination with remote environments, ever-changing conditions, and unpredictable wildlife and elements. We provide area expertise to help you safely get your Alaska dream shot. A custom Alaska photo tour caters to all levels of photographers, novice to pro. Based on your wishes, style and budget, custom Alaska photo tours and guiding services can be all-inclusive, or partially inclusive; guided by a professional photographer, or self-guided.
